Output 23fbd4e97d0820541af4b3cddfed2dd0a611dbca1ebebd9dec1d2fdc36d45885:2

value
355742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56858fbcb9931a2dbd82ef3804f44fb88289840d OP_EQUAL
address
39aW349PnVMNXpzfd8R94SbmdPvCwgy6z7
transaction
23fbd4e97d0820541af4b3cddfed2dd0a611dbca1ebebd9dec1d2fdc36d45885
spent
true